## Ownership

The batch email digest scheduler (aka Driftpost) is what decides when users get their daily and weekly roll-ups. If a customer says digests arrived twice, or at 3 a.m. local time, it's almost certainly the timezone-bucketing job in this repo. Don't restart the worker pool yourself — that can double-send. File a ticket and flag it to the owner, whose name is below.

account owner for bawip-tahag: Raleth Quenok

## Deployment

Both client SDKs (Lattice-JS and Lattice-Go) now ship from the same release train. Parity is enforced at build time: any endpoint present in one surface and absent in the other fails the pipeline. Auth flows, retry semantics, and payload signing are identical by contract. No SDK-specific escape hatches remain; review the parity manifest if in doubt. Deployments pin both SDKs to the same version tag. The parity checker runs with this configuration:

deployment values, fahap-hahaf:
[casdor]
port = 9200
region = south-2
host = casdor.qirvanworks.corp
timeout_ms = 3000
retries = 4

## Action Item: Cold bucket archival (Glimmervault)

Owner: on-call. The Glimmervault outage showed cold buckets were never aging out, so the archiver scanned everything on each pass and starved the hot path. Fix: enforce age-based archival with a hard per-pass cap. Run the archiver during the Kestrel-region quiet window only; abort if scan time exceeds the budget. Verify metrics land in the archival dashboard after the first run and confirm restore tests still pass. The cap, age cutoff, and window are defined in the constants below.

tuning constants:
QUOTAS = {
    "druwyn": 5,
    "holix": 5,
    "zorath": 5,
    "holwyn": 10,
}

## Trace gaps between services

Symptom: spans from `orderflow-svc` missing in Spanlace UI. Cause is usually a dropped `x-trace-ctx` header at the Gatewick proxy. Check proxy config first; the header allowlist must include trace context. Next, confirm the collector sidecar is running. To query the Spanlace ingest API directly and verify span receipt, call `/v1/spans/recent` with the debug bearer token below.

portal login ticket: eyJhbGciOiJIUzI1NiIsInR5cCI6IkpXVCJ9.eyJzdWIiOiIMjvRAf3PEFIn0.nuv9gjixLtnr